INTERACTIVE GAMBLING (PLAYER PROTECTION) ACT 1998 - SECT 40
Return of licence for endorsement of changed conditions
40 Return of licence for endorsement of changed conditions
(1) The licensed provider must return the licence to the Minister within 7
days of receiving the condition notice notifying a change of conditions,
unless the licensed provider has a reasonable excuse. Penalty— Maximum
penalty—40 penalty units.
(2) On receiving the interactive gambling
licence, the Minister must— (a) amend the licence in an appropriate way and
return the amended licence to the licensed provider; or
(b) if the Minister
does not consider it is practicable to amend the licence—issue a replacement
licence, incorporating the changed conditions, to the licensed provider.
(3)
A change of conditions does not depend on the interactive gambling licence
being amended to record the change or a replacement licence being issued.
(4)
A change of conditions takes effect on a day agreed between the Minister and
the licensed provider or, in the absence of an agreement, the later of the
following— (a) the day the condition notice notifying the change is given to
the licensed provider;
(b) if a later day is stated in the condition
notice—the later day.
